A Westley-Richards ZAR carbine in 577-450, as bought by the South African Republic. Large Francotte-style action. Not too many of these were made, and this one is still in shooting condition. Shoots quite nicely too, if you can manage the sights...

Recoil is 'stout', but not too bad with 420gr bullets and 85 grs of Fg, but it does look quite impressive though. Overall length is about the same as a .310 cadet, but the hole in the muzzle is a bit bigger though, just like the cartridge...
